Nice paper on variants in the tricky glutamate transporter / anion channel #SLC1A2 / #EAAT2 which is assoziated with episodic #ataxia type 6. They found three types: overall loss-of-function, mild gain-of-anion function, and mixed loss-of-transport/gain-of-anion function.

A purple graphic with white text and a hand-drawn unicorn with a pink mane, golden horn, and green stars around it. The heading reads "LOOKING FOR THE ONE IN A MILLION." The text explains that the CACNA1S gene is essential for skeletal muscle contraction and vital for functions like respiration, posture, communication, locomotion, and heat production. It states that mutations in CACNA1S are linked to symptoms such as muscle weakness, delayed motor development, scoliosis, dysmorphic facial features, periodic paralysis, and susceptibility to malignant hyperthermia. Nice paper by Waxmans lab: A thorough assessment of the Cannabinoids CBD, CBG and CBN and their effect on the voltage gated sodium channel Nav 1.8. All three inhibit Nav 1.8 in the micromolar range. (www.pnas.org/doi/10.1073/...), confirming prior work by Beans lab on CBD (doi.org/10.1523/jneu...).
